## Formula sandbox tuning

User-supplied formulas in Gridmoor execute inside a restricted interpreter with hard ceilings on time, memory, and call depth. Reviewers should confirm any change to these ceilings is justified in the PR description, since raising them widens the abuse surface. Defaults were chosen from production traces. The current limits are as follows.

limits module of tafog-fawip:
WEIGHTS = {
    "julix": 57,
    "lamys": 992,
    "kasvan": 209,
    "quenok": 750,
    "alddor": 259,
    "oliath": 1009,
    "wenix": 815,
}

Capacity note for the Bramblewick export retry queue. Failed exports are requeued with exponential backoff, and the queue depth is our main capacity signal: sustained depth above the high-water mark means downstream Pellis storage is saturated, not that we need more workers. As the new contractor, please don't raise worker counts without checking storage latency first — it usually makes things worse. Retry timing, backoff caps, and the high-water threshold are all driven by the constants shown below.

limits module of yagef-bajog:
TIERS = {
    "druael": 370,
    "tamix": 286,
    "pelius": 541,
    "pelael": 78,
    "pelox": 47,
    "ralath": 533,
    "drumir": 801,
}

Internal Memo — Insurance Renewal

To the finance team: the annual policy with Kestrelgate Assurance renews at month-end. The quoted premium rises 6%, reflecting last year's flood claim at the Dornley warehouse. Coverage terms are otherwise unchanged, and the broker has confirmed no further adjustments are expected. Please reserve accordingly and reconcile the prepaid schedule. Wider planning implications appear in the confidential note below.

confidential, kagep-kahof: Druokax Systems plans to lower the Ulaath list price by 53 percent in March.

Handing off the Quillbus broker upgrade (4.x to 5.1) to Dario. Cluster is half-migrated; mixed-version mode is supported but TLS cert rotation must finish before cutover. No auth model changes, though the admin API gained two new endpoints worth reviewing. Open questions and the migration checklist are tracked on the internal page below.

dashboard of taduf-bawef = https://jira.lumicsys.internal/projects/display/browse/b1cbf89d